What Maintenance Does an Automatic T-Shirt Bag Making Machine Require

Introduction to Automatic T-Shirt Bag Machines

Automatic T-Shirt Bag Making Machines are advanced equipment designed to produce a wide range of bags, from simple shopping bags to intricately designed T-Shirt bags. These machines can handle various materials, including HDPE, LDPE, PLA, and PBAT (biodegradable), making them versatile for diverse applications. While they offer numerous advantages, such as high-speed continuous operation and advanced sealing mechanisms, they also require meticulous maintenance to maintain consistent quality and meet production standards.

Downtime and Production Disruptions

One of the primary challenges in maintaining T-Shirt bag making machines is minimizing downtime. Downtime can lead to significant losses in productivity and revenue, especially in high-volume operations. Common issues include mechanical failures, seal damage, and software malfunctions. Preventing these issues through regular maintenance is crucial.


Cost Implications of Downtime

Every minute of downtime translates into lost revenue and production capacity. According to industry data, downtime can cost a factory anywhere from a few hundred to thousands of dollars in lost production and labor costs. Preventing breakdowns not only saves money but also enhances overall operational efficiency.


Ensuring High-Quality Production

Maintaining the machine's precision is vital for consistent product quality. This includes ensuring that the cutting and sealing mechanisms operate smoothly, temperature settings are accurate, and the machine's sensors and controls function optimally. Failure to do so can result in defective bags, which can lead to customer dissatisfaction and potential losses.


Preventive Maintenance Schedule

Proactive maintenance is critical for the longevity of T-Shirt bag making machines. A well-planned preventive maintenance schedule can help identify potential issues before they become major problems. Here's a comprehensive schedule you can follow:


Monthly Maintenance:

  • Check Air Filters: Air filters help keep the machine's interior clean by preventing dust and debris from entering. Regular cleaning and replacement of filters is essential to maintain air quality and prevent contamination.
  • Inspect Seals and Valves: Check the integrity of all seals and valves to ensure they are properly lubricated and free from damage. Replace any worn-out seals or damaged valves immediately to prevent air leaks and ensure proper bag sealing.
  • Test Safety Features: Installations like emergency stops and safety switches must be functional. Test them regularly to ensure they work correctly in case of a malfunction.

Quarterly Maintenance:

  • Servo Motor Inspection: Servo motors are critical components that drive the machine's movements. Regular inspection, lubrication, and replacement of worn-out components can prevent motor failures.
  • Oil Change: Change the machine's lubricating oil to ensure smooth operation. This helps reduce wear and tear on moving parts and extends the machine's lifespan.
  • Check Pulleys and Belts: Ensure all pulleys and belts are in good condition and aligned correctly. Misaligned or worn-out belts and pulleys can cause vibrations and increased wear.

Yearly Maintenance:

  • Deep Cleaning: Perform a deep clean of the entire machine. This includes removing all parts, cleaning them thoroughly, and reassembling the machine. This process helps eliminate accumulated dust and debris, which can affect performance.
  • Replace Worn Parts: Identify and replace any worn or damaged parts to prevent failures. This includes seals, bearings, and other critical components.
  • Software Update: Ensure the machine's control system is up-to-date with the latest software and firmware. This can provide improved performance, stability, and safety features.

Component-Wise Maintenance: Seals and Servos

How to Replace Seals

Seals are one of the most critical components in a T-Shirt bag making machine. They ensure air tightness and prevent leaks that could result in poor-quality bags. Regular inspection and replacement are essential to maintain optimal performance.


Steps to Replace Seals:

  1. Shut Down the Machine: Disconnect the power source and ensure the machine is completely powered off.
  2. Disassemble: Remove the relevant parts to access the seals. Use appropriate tools to remove any screws, connectors, or fasteners.
  3. Inspect Old Seals: Before removing the old seals, inspect them for damage, wear, or signs of contamination. This can help identify potential issues.
  4. Install New Seals: Carefully install new seals, ensuring they are positioned correctly and securely. Apply a thin layer of lubrication to help them slide smoothly into place.
  5. Test: Once the new seals are installed, test the machine to ensure they are functioning correctly. Check for any signs of leaks or improper sealing.

Common Issues with Seals:

  • Wear and Tear: Over time, seals can deteriorate due to friction and environmental factors. Regular inspection is crucial to identify worn-out seals.
  • Contamination: Dust and debris can contaminate seals, leading to poor sealing performance. Frequent cleaning can help prevent this issue.

Servo Motor Maintenance

Servo motors are precision components that control the movements of the machine. Regular inspection and servicing can ensure their longevity and optimal performance.


Servo Motor Inspection:

  1. Inspect Bearings and Bushings: Check for signs of wear or damage. Replace any worn components promptly.
  2. Lubrication: Apply the appropriate lubricant to bearings and bushings to reduce friction and prevent wear.
  3. Rotor Check: Inspect the rotor for any damage or abnormal wear patterns. This can indicate issues with the motor's operation.
  4. Encoder Check: Ensure the encoder is functioning correctly and securely aligned. This is crucial for accurate position feedback.

Servo Motor Replacement:

  1. Remove the Motor: Carefully remove the old servo motor, ensuring all connections are disconnected.
  2. Install New Motor: Solder and connect the new servo motor, ensuring it is securely mounted and properly aligned.
  3. Calibrate: Calibrate the new motor to ensure it aligns with the machine's control system. This involves adjusting the settings to match the machine's specifications.

Regular Cleaning and Inspection

Regular cleaning and inspection are essential to maintain the machine's performance and longevity. Here are some critical areas to focus on:


Cleaning the Machine

  1. Disassemble Parts: Remove all exterior and interior parts such as seals, belts, and sensors to access them for cleaning.
  2. Use Compressed Air: Use compressed air to remove dust and debris from surfaces, sensors, and connectors.
  3. Inspect Sensors and Connectors: Check for any signs of damage or contamination. Clean them carefully with a lint-free cloth.
  4. Lubricate Moving Parts: Apply a thin layer of lubricant to moving parts like bearings and bushings to reduce friction.

Inspection Checklist

  • Check for Worn Parts: Look for any signs of wear or damage on components like gears, pulleys, and belts.
  • Inspect Sealing Mechanisms: Ensure seals are intact and free from cracks or tears.
  • Test Electronic Components: Verify that sensors, switches, and control panels are functioning correctly.

Lubrication Schedule

  • Monthly Oil Change: Regularly change the machine's lubricating oil to maintain smooth operation.
  • Lubricate Moving Parts: Apply lubricant to moving parts to prevent wear and reduce friction.

Advanced Tips

Operator Training

Providing regular training and refresher courses for operators can significantly improve maintenance efficiency. This includes:


  • Software Updates: Ensure operators are trained on the latest software updates and control system functionalities.
  • Emergency Procedures: Conduct regular drills for emergency shutdowns and repair procedures.
  • Preventive Maintenance Practices: Train operators on the importance of regular cleaning and inspection routines.

Monitoring and Alert Systems

Implementing advanced monitoring and alert systems can help detect potential issues before they become critical. Consider:


  • Real-Time Monitoring: Use sensors and control software to monitor key metrics like temperature, pressure, and motor performance in real-time.
  • Alert Systems: Set up alert systems to notify operators of any deviations or anomalies, enabling prompt action.

Customized Maintenance Programs

Tailor the maintenance program to the specific requirements of your machine and production needs. This ensures that the maintenance schedule is responsive to your machine's unique operational demands.


Data-Driven Maintenance

Leverage data analysis to optimize your maintenance program. Collect data on machine performance and use it to predict and prevent issues before they occur.
